Job summary
* Customer Service: Greet customers in a friendly and courteous manner, offering assistance and ensuring a positive shopping experience. * Processing Transactions: Accurately scan and process purchases using the point-of-sale (POS) system, handling cash, debit/credit card payments, and gift cards. * Bagging Groceries: Efficiently bag groceries, ensuring that items are packed securely and appropriately, with an emphasis on preventing damage to fragile items. * Handling Returns and Exchanges: Process returns, refunds, and exchanges according to store policies, ensuring proper documentation and communication with the customer. * Maintaining Cleanliness: Keep the checkout area clean and organized, wiping down surfaces and restocking bags, receipt paper, and other supplies as needed. * Price Verification: Assist customers with price checks and resolve any discrepancies regarding product pricing, including applying discounts or promotions when applicable. * Balancing Cash Drawer: At the end of each shift, count the cash drawer to ensure it balances with sales totals, and report any discrepancies to the supervisor. * Handling Inquiries: Answer customer questions regarding store policies, promotions, or products, and direct them to appropriate store staff for further assistance when needed. * Promoting Store Programs: Inform customers about store loyalty programs, discounts, and promotions, encouraging participation to enhance their shopping experience. * Assisting with Checkout Line Flow: Monitor the flow of customers through checkout lanes, opening additional lanes when necessary and ensuring customers are served efficiently. * Following Safety and Security Protocols: Adhere to store security policies when handling cash and payments to prevent theft, fraud, or errors. * Other duties as required
